Matthew Chapter 26-28 Quiz for TeensOnline version

Test your knowledge of the events and characters in the last chapters of the Gospel of Matthew! Answer whether each statement is true or false based on the scripture from Matthew Chapters 26 to 28.

by Kingdom Youth Kingdom Activities
1

Judas Iscariot was one of the twelve disciples who remained loyal.

2

Jesus did not predict his own death.

3

The chief priests conspired to arrest Jesus secretly.

4

Jesus prayed in the Garden of Gethsemane.

5

Peter was the one who betrayed Jesus.

6

Jesus was buried in a public cemetery.

7

The resurrection of Jesus happened on the first day of the week.

8

Jesus was crucified at Golgotha.

9

Jesus turned water into wine at the Last Supper.

10

The Roman soldiers celebrated Jesus' crucifixion.

11

The disciples abandoned Jesus before his arrest.

12

The tomb of Jesus was found empty on the third day.

13

Mary, the mother of Jesus, was the first to witness the resurrection.

14

Jesus was stoned to death.

15

The Last Supper took place before Jesus' crucifixion.

16

Peter denied knowing Jesus three times.

17

Jesus was betrayed by Judas Iscariot.

18

Mary Magdalene was the first to see the resurrected Jesus.

19

Jesus instructed his disciples to spread the Gospel.

20

Pilate washed his hands to show he was not guilty of Jesus' blood.
